Self-Working: A Novel and Integrative Approach to Psychotherapy
by Reza Johari Fard
Over the past century, psychotherapy has evolved through diverse schools of thought-each focusing on specific dimensions of human experience, from unconscious processes and emotional regulation to cognition and interpersonal relationships. While these approaches have significantly advanced clinical practice, the challenge of theoretical integration remains unresolved.
Self-Working offers a novel and coherent integrative model designed to bridge this gap. Grounded in systems thinking and informed by contemporary psychotherapy integration, this model provides a structured yet flexible framework for understanding psychological growth across time.
At the core of the Self-Working approach lies a three-dimensional therapeutic pathway:
Being-on-This - working with the individual's past, personality, and foundational psychological structures.
Becoming-to-That - actively constructing the future through values, strengths, and personal meaning.
Life Theme - cultivating conscious, responsible, and creative living in the present moment.
Unlike symptom-focused or single-school therapies, Self-Working conceptualizes psychotherapy as a lifelong educational and developmental process, integrating body, emotion, cognition, and attention into a unified clinical framework.
This book is designed not only as a theoretical contribution, but as a practical clinical guide-offering therapists, researchers, and graduate students a comprehensive model for working with clients in a holistic, future-oriented, and culturally sensitive manner.
